
New York-based band, 2/14, dropped their debut full-length album, Adrienne's Garden, towards the end of last year. An 11-track ride that comes fully equipped with ripping instrumentals and poppy vocal flows, this is a dynamic pop punk/alternative release that hits feelings of nostalgia while also feeling new. What a release!
There's a raw energy that's present in the album that can really only be captured by bands living in the punk world. That raw energy also adds an emotional and relatable element to the mix. We think this is a big reason why this album feels so complete. Each track flows seamlessly into the next here. The heartfelt lyrical work also plays a big role in making these songs feel so inviting. We're not sure what they have planned next, but this was a great introduction to the band's sound, and Adrienne's Garden proves that 2/14 is a project that more fans of the style need to keep on their radar.
